So fun! This was my first time making a cake in any other shape than the regular old cake pans, and I think it turned out great! The diagrams were easy to follow and overall pretty simple to complete. I took the good advice of another reviewer and slightly froze the cake before frosting to prevent crumbs from mixing with the icing. The only adjustment I had to make was I needed TWO cans of white icing... when I mixed the leftover chocolate with the white, it was way to dark to be skin colored, and wouldn't have been quite enough either. I also substituted cut marshmallow for the gum for the teeth- worked great!
